Truist Unveils Venture Capital Division with New Fintech Investment

September 17, 2020, 08:00 AM
Filed Under: New Venture
Related: Truist Financial

Truist Financial Corporation announced the launch of Truist Ventures, a corporate venture capital division created by integrating investments in technology companies from the heritage SunTrust brand with BB&T Ventures. The firm, which also is announcing its latest deal with global payments network Veem, is focusing on strategic partnerships and investments to bring novel solutions to Truist clients and deliver on the company's purpose to inspire and build better lives and communities.

Truist has appointed Vanessa Indriolo Vreeland, a seasoned executive with more than 20 years of private equity, venture capital and banking experience, to lead Truist Ventures.

"We are a different kind of venture firm. As the venture capital division of the sixth largest bank in the U.S., we have the scale to provide the capital early-stage companies need to grow. Yet, we're nimble enough to deliver meaningful access to the deep domain expertise from our extensive network of teams across technology, investment banking, capital markets and innovation," Vreeland said. "We work closely with the companies in which we invest, leveraging our executive-level talent and industry experts to help them grow."

Truist Ventures' investment focus stretches beyond traditional financial technology into disruptive technologies that enable Truist to deliver a human touch in new ways. It seeks companies that have the potential to help redefine financial services and improve financial outcomes for Truist clients.

The firm's newest undertaking as Truist Ventures' is leading the latest funding round for global payments network Veem. Veem solves a critical pain point for small- and medium-sized businesses with a multi-rail technology system that allows for seamless global payments. This funding will go toward the development of a robust channel partner program that will widen their global footprint and help strengthen and expand their product suite and capabilities.
